About me

YOU ARE NECESSARY! If you question this on any level, than I believe you are meant to be here at this this moment. So, let’s get started. I am a Licensed Professional Counselor and a Certified Employee Assistance Professional in Mississippi. I have 27 years experience in the field of mental and behavioral health services. This includes counseling individuals from diverse backgrounds on a variety of issues, that includes, but not limited to, work-life balance, stress management, depression, anxiety, trauma, and anger management. It is most important to help clients explore the approaches that is the best fit for their needs and readiness. Therefore I take an eclectic approach in counseling, using therapeutic frameworks that includes, Person Centered, Cognitive-Behavior Therapy, Solution-Focused Therapy, Mindfulness, Motivational Interviewing, and Positive Psychology. My training and experience is significant to the services provided, however, it is my commitment in guiding my clients with an open heart and an open mind that is paramount. I believe everyone deserves a safe place to be vulnerable as they work toward their optimal level of mental well-being. I look forward to partnering with you on this journey.
